如何在UI和Web Api之间共享会话?

时间:2017-09-27 20:48:06

标签: c# asp.net asp.net-web-api session-state sql-session-state

我有两个申请。一个是用户界面,它在会话中存储UserID等信息。另一个是与UI通信的web api。我需要与web api分享这个UI会话。

1-我知道不建议使用Web Api会话,但出于我的目的,我需要这样做。

2-我因为网络农场而使用sessionState mode =“SQLServer”。

<sessionState mode="SQLServer" sqlConnectionString="Server=servername;Database=dbname;User ID=username;Password=password;Application Name=name;" cookieless="false" allowCustomSqlDatabase="true" timeout="20"/>

<machineKey validationKey="SomeKey" decryptionKey="somekey" validation="SHA1" decryption="AES" />

两个应用程序具有相同的配置,但由于某种原因,我不知道,它做得不对。

3 - 我还在当地开发它。

有人可以帮助我吗?

0 个答案:

没有答案